Center Parcs Longleat Forest

Center Parcs Longleat Forest makes up a large area of Longleat Forest in the county of Wiltshire, England. It is next to the Longleat Safari Park, approximately 5 miles east of Frome and a few miles west of Warminster and opened in 1994. The site

The site comprises three main areas of activity (Plaza, Village Square and the Jardin Des Sports) surrounded by other activity areas and enough villas to hold approximately 4000 people at any one time. The Plaza is the main building on the park, comprising the swimming pool (known as the Subtropical Swimming Paradise); seven shops; five restaurants; a bowling alley; an arcade and "The Venue" (a multi-function suite of rooms). The Village Square is in the centre of the park, and comprises three restaurants, the medical centre and the rangers lodge. The Jardin Des Sports is the next venue along and is situated towards the south west of the park. The Jardin Des Sports (regularly mentioned as "JDS") is the venue where most of the sporting activities take place, either inside or close by. Aside from the sports, the "JDS" also comprises two restaurants, two shops, an arcade and a photography studio. The watersports lake, with its own beach kiosk, is also close to the "JDS".
